7 Press to start the adjustment. The CAL
annunciator flashes to indicate the calibration is in
progress.
• Successful completion of each adjustment value is
indicated by a short beep and the primary display
briefly showing PASS.
• An adjustment failure is indicated by a long beep, the
primary display showing FAiL and a calibration error
number appearing in the secondary display. Check the
input value, range, function, and entered adjustment
value to correct the problem and repeat the adjustment
step.
8 Repeat steps 3 through 7 for each gain adjustment point
shown in the table.
9 Verify the Frequency Gain adjustments using the
“Frequency Gain Verification Test” on page 81.
